2. PROJECT ADVISORY SERVICES
Proactive construction management services can greatly reduce the inherent risks associated with the
construction process and significantly increase the likelihood that a project will finish on time and within
budget. Columbia Consulting’s construction professionals bring decades of experience to assist you with the
key components of your construction project – plans and specifications, scheduling, and project administra-
tion, as well as timely resolution of changes and unforeseen challenges.

Planning
Successfully managing a project begins in the initial planning and pre-construction phases, the time
when project scope, schedule and budget are defined. We partner with you at the earliest stages,
reviewing plans, budgets, and schedules. By identifying risks and ensuring effective management
strategies are in place, we help you create a successful project.
Project Controls
As a project progresses, if an effective system of controls are not in place, it becomes difficult to
meet the project’s goals and objectives. Using the right technology and tools, we track project
progress; identify potential cost overruns, delays, and key performance indicators; and help
you make informed decisions.

Schedule Analysis
Analytical tools help evaluate a project’s critical path. Columbia Consulting prepares and
analyzes as-planned and as-built schedules. Our analysis focuses on project impacts,
and our summary of project issues and delays provides
a realistic assessment of potential liability.

Asset Repositioning
Owners, developers, and financial institutions all understand that as market conditions fluctuate,
assets must be repositioned and “change-use” considered. We help you maximize a project’s value
by providing strategic alternative uses for land/assets. Master planning of assets includes: mixed use,
office, retail, and residential projects.
Development Services
Real estate development services we provide include: site selection, planning, feasibility analysis,
public entitlements, and development management. Columbia Consulting has the expertise to
manage all facets and phases of the development process for you.
Inspection Services
Construction inspection services to owners and financial institutions will include drawing reviews,
budget analysis, payment request, and payment request reviews. These services enhance and
represent the lenders’ interests in the development project.

Dispute Resolution Services
When disputes or challenges arise, analysis of technical, schedule, and cost issues may be required.
Our knowledge of industry standards of practice, effective expert testimony, and litigation support
services fills the void. Our work clearly identifies the root causes and helps determine responsibility
for changes, delay, acceleration, disruption, and other events. When appropriate, we quantify
economic damages. Our involvement enhances our clients’ decision-making capabilities about
dispute resolution options and can significantly reduce financial risk and exposure.
